Output f21065869080aa84c87ce18fe62febaa7d9c267812b8aba6e8f222b8e224f77b:12

value
3660000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 efda3626dd74ea0535b262d282260b95124ca27c OP_EQUALVERIFY OP_CHECKSIG
address
1NsDuT8Btgj45MfLELJ5Z5DXB1NWbXquCP
transaction
f21065869080aa84c87ce18fe62febaa7d9c267812b8aba6e8f222b8e224f77b
confirmations
289542
spent
true